What Is Structural Engineering for House Inspections?

Structural engineering focuses on ensuring the safety, stability, and strength of a building’s structural components, such as the foundation, walls, roof, and flooring. A structural engineer will assess the integrity of these components and identify any underlying issues that might not be immediately visible.

In a typical house inspection, a generalist inspector may check the overall condition of the property, including the plumbing, electrical, and cosmetic features. However, a structural engineer is trained to evaluate the fundamental building elements that support the entire structure. They have the expertise to identify problems such as foundation cracks, structural weaknesses, and water damage that could compromise the property’s long-term stability.

Why Structural Inspections Are Essential in Brisbane

Structural engineering for house inspections Brisbane’s subtropical climate poses specific challenges to the structural integrity of buildings. High humidity, heavy rainfall, and occasional flooding can contribute to wear and tear on a home’s structure. Moisture infiltration, shifting soil, and timber decay are common problems that many homes in Brisbane face. As such, it’s important to have a professional structural engineer assess the building to detect potential risks early.

Moreover, Brisbane’s real estate market has seen considerable growth over the past few years, leading to an increase in both new construction and older homes being sold. Many older homes, particularly those built before stringent building codes were implemented, might be prone to structural issues that could go unnoticed without a proper inspection. A pre-purchase house inspection that includes a structural engineering evaluation can help buyers avoid costly repairs down the road.

Common Issues Found in Brisbane Homes

Several structural issues are particularly prevalent in Brisbane homes. While some may be visible to the untrained eye, others are subtle and require an expert’s knowledge to diagnose. A structural engineer will thoroughly inspect your home for the following common issues:

  1. Foundation Problems
    One of the most critical aspects of a property’s stability is its foundation. Over time, moisture fluctuations and shifting soil can cause foundations to crack, settle, or even collapse. Soil movement is a common issue in Brisbane due to the region’s clay-rich soil, which expands and contracts with changes in moisture. A structural engineer Brisbane will inspect for cracks, uneven settling, and signs of subsidence that could indicate foundation problems.
  2. Water Damage
    Brisbane’s rainy season can lead to water intrusion, which can cause significant damage to a home’s structure if left unchecked. Water can seep into walls, floors, and foundations, leading to timber rot, mould growth, and weakened structural components. Structural engineers are skilled at identifying the early signs of water damage, which might not be visible on the surface.
  3. Roof and Timber Frame Issues
    The timber frames of homes in Brisbane are susceptible to decay due to the humid climate. Structural engineers will examine the condition of the timber, looking for signs of rotting, pest infestations, and general wear and tear. Similarly, roofs should be carefully checked for damage to the framing, as well as leaks that can cause extensive damage to the interior.
  4. Cracks and Structural Shifts
    Cracks in the walls, ceilings, and floors can indicate underlying structural problems. Some minor cracking can be normal due to settling, but large or growing cracks often signal more serious issues. A structural inspection Brisbane will evaluate the cause of these cracks, whether they are related to soil movement, poor construction, or other underlying factors.
  5. Pest Damage
    Brisbane homes are prone to infestations of termites, which can cause significant damage to timber structures if not treated promptly. Structural engineers often check for signs of termite activity, including hollowed timber or crumbling foundations, to ensure the home is pest-free.

How a Structural Engineering Inspection Differs from a Regular House Inspection

A regular building inspection provides a general overview of the property’s condition, focusing on visible and accessible areas of the home. This includes checking appliances, plumbing, electrical systems, and the general condition of the walls, ceilings, and floors. While these inspections are essential for identifying non-structural issues, they often do not cover the full scope of potential structural problems that could be present.

In contrast, a structural engineering inspection goes deeper, providing a more thorough evaluation of the building’s foundation and load-bearing elements. Structural engineers use advanced tools and techniques to assess hidden issues that might not be apparent to an untrained observer. For example, they may conduct soil tests, check for movement in load-bearing walls, and inspect the home’s structural frame for hidden weaknesses. This type of inspection is particularly useful when dealing with older homes or properties in areas prone to soil movement or moisture damage.
